A ZCTA — ZIP Code Tabulation Area — is the U.S. Census Bureau's area approximation of a USPS ZIP code, not the ZIP code itself. HMDA reports no postal geography at all, so these rows are census tracts grouped by the Census 2020 tract-to-ZCTA relationship file: each tract is counted once, in the single ZCTA covering the most of its land. Housing figures are HMDA tract attributes for activity year 2025, summed over the tracts each ZIP area owns — a ZIP area that owns no tract shows an em-dash, never a zero.

ALSO CHECKED

18 more data areas were checked for McKinley County and did not earn a tab. A missing tab and an unasked question look the same on screen, so each one is named with the reason it is missing.

  • WRONG GRAIN
    FHA

    FHA Neighborhood Watch DOES publish county rows, but keys them on a free-text county NAME (“CHITTENDEN|VT”), not a FIPS code, and the single-family endorsement snapshot's property_county is likewise free text. Joining either to a county FIPS by name would attribute one county's delinquency to another wherever a name repeats, so FHA is a state-grain tab only until a curated name→FIPS crosswalk exists

  • WRONG GRAIN
    Fannie / Freddie

    the FHFA public-use database publishes single-family acquisitions at STATE and CENSUS-TRACT grain; no county rollup is published or loaded, and rolling tracts up to counties would double-count the tracts that straddle a county line

  • WRONG GRAIN
    GSE credit-risk transfer

    CAS and STACR loan-level disclosures publish PROPERTY STATE and a 3-digit zip; neither carries a county code, so credit-risk-transfer collateral cannot be attributed to a county

  • WRONG GRAIN
    Ginnie Mae

    Ginnie Mae's loan-level disclosure publishes PROPERTY STATE and nothing finer — there is no county, ZIP or tract field in the file, so agency-pool collateral has no county grain at all. Fair-lending context: denial rates and demographic figures shown here are descriptive statistics derived from public HMDA and U.S. Census data. HMDA does not contain the credit, income, or underwriting variables that explain most lending outcomes, so a difference between lenders or areas is a statistical observation about published data — not evidence of, and not a determination of, discrimination or redlining by any institution.
